There are two parts to this...

First, every person who submits a review is told that moderation can take up to 5 business days. A few "special cases" get forwarded to me and take a little longer. Over 80% are usually done with the screening process within 2 or 3 business days.

Anyone who submits a review which is not approved within 5 business days can read this...

https://www.forexpeacearmy.com/community/threads/hey-dude-wheres-my-review.42719/

If the text doesn't explain it, there's a contact form for the reviewer to fill out.

There's a reason for this delay. Every review is checked automatically and then passed over to the review moderation team for manual checks. IBs try to leave glowing reviews with their affiliate links. Some even try to turn their affiliate link into a separate review page. Recovery room scammers try to tell fake stories about where to get help with scams. Spammers try to advertise all sorts of products unrelated to forex. People try to post "Please leave reviews" as a review. If the big Add Your Review button displayed 3 times on each review page fails to get reviews, a "please leave a review" message in the reviews list won't help.

My favorite fake reviews are from companies trying to submit fake "client" reviews for themselves. Those do get approved, but with some changes. The rating is set to zero stars and the review is modified to make the bad behavior of the company visible to readers.


Second, many companies do have few or even no reviews. Reviews are supposed to be left by clients. I've got no way to force anyone to submit reviews. I do not have the time go out and open live accounts at 300 brokers just to be able to leave one review for each of them.

If you see people complaining about a scammy broker which has no reviews on its FPA review page, then please encourage those people to come and submit a review.
